#243d19 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#243d19 is composed of 14.1% red, 23.9%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41% cyan, 0% magenta, 59% yellow and 76.1% black. It has a hue angle of 101.7 degrees, a saturation of 41.9% and a lightness of 16.9%. #243d19 color hex could be obtained by blending #487a32 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#243d19 color description : Very dark desaturated green.

#243d19 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#243d19 has RGB values of R:36, G:61,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 2374937.

Shades and Tints of #243d19

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030502 is the darkest color, while #f8fbf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#243d19

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2a2c2a is the less saturated color, while #1b5402 is the most saturated one.
